The O.K. Corral stands as one of the most iconic historical landmarks in the United States, situated in the heart of Tombstone, Arizona. This site is renowned for the infamous gunfight that took place on October 26, 1881, between lawmen led by Wyatt Earp and a group of outlaws. Today, visitors can immerse themselves in this captivating piece of Wild West history through meticulously curated exhibits and engaging reenactments that vividly bring to life the events of that fateful day. As you stroll through the corral, the atmosphere is charged with the spirit of adventure and the tales of courageous lawmen and notorious outlaws that shaped the American frontier. In addition to the gunfight reenactments, the O.K. Corral features a history museum that delves deeper into the legacy of Tombstone and its role in the Wild West. Exhibits include artifacts, photographs, and stories that illustrate the challenges and triumphs faced by the pioneers who settled in this rugged landscape. The site also offers guided tours where knowledgeable staff share insights and anecdotes about the characters that made this town legendary. Whether you’re a history buff, a family looking for an educational outing, or simply a curious traveler, the O.K. Corral is a must-visit destination that promises a memorable journey into the past. Make sure to allocate enough time to explore the surrounding areas of Tombstone, where you can find additional attractions like the Bird Cage Theatre and the Tombstone Courthouse State Historic Park, making your visit to the O.K. Corral an integral part of your Wild West adventure.

Local tips

  • Arrive early to secure a good spot for the reenactment, as seating can fill up quickly.
  • Check the daily schedule for reenactment times and other events to make the most of your visit.
  • Wear comfortable shoes as you will be walking around the historical site and exploring nearby attractions.
  • Consider purchasing a combination ticket that includes other local attractions for better value.
  • Don’t forget your camera; the O.K. Corral and its surroundings provide plenty of photo opportunities.
